Defining Ready Reckoner Rate

A Ready Reckoner Rate, also called RRR, circle rate, and annual statement rate (ASR), varies for each state, city, and locality. It is the measured value of an immovable (residential, industrial, commercial, and land/plot) real estate property regularized by the particular state government. In an effort to make precise property valuations, In India, every state government prepares and issues locality-wise rates annually collated as Ready Reckoner Rate [RRR]. So, the circle rate/RRR is like a benchmark without which no real estate property type transactions can occur in the respective state/city/locality. A ready reckoner rate is revised periodically based on market dynamics. And each state, city, and locality has a specific ready reckoner rate of its own. Basically, it gives the home buyer a clear picture of how much he is supposed to pay for the property established in a particular area. Besides, since the market rate in most cases is greater than the ready reckoner rate, it is always advisable to invest in an area with a lesser gap between the two. As the increase in RRR infers higher market rates and higher market rates lead to higher purchasing costs for a buyer.

What is the Ready Reckoner Rate in Thane?

Maharashtra is an umbrella for many amazing cities, and one such city is Thane, also noted as the “City of Lakes.” The district of the Konkan region is well known for its recreational places and for thriving real estate projects. So, various reasons make the city more promising in real estate, including lower stamp duty prices and lower RRR. Presently, the state’s stamp duty and registration charges are up to 5% and 1%, respectively. 

Maharashtra Government decides on ready reckoner rate Thane every year-end, and the rates are valid for the financial year. They are decided after Maharashtra Stamp Act and the Maharashtra Stamp Rule, 1995. 

The stamps and registration department of Maharashtra state prepared the RRR or ASR(Annual Schedule of Rate) of properties in Maharashtra. It is made to assess the market value of properties for the stamp duty. The ASR is available through the web application “e-ASR “ on the government portal.

How to check Ready Reckoner Rates in Thane?

If you decide to buy a property in a specific area, you must make a practice to check RRR. You can check the rates of any property on the official portal at www.igrmaharashtra.gov.in > SARATHI > Valuation. You can personally visit the sub-registrar’s office and check rates for the particular area in which you will buy a property. Click on eASR and find state, city, and area-wise rates to check the data online.

The following steps would really help you:

Marathi and English languages are available for the link.

Step 1: Click on the official link, scroll down to find “Online services.” You find ‘eASR’ in online services; click ‘process’ from the drop-down. If you want to look at the user’s guide and check FAQs before proceeding, select accordingly.

Step 2:  Click on ठाणे (Thane), it will take you to a fresh page of Annual Statement of Rates. 

Step 3: Here, select taluka and village (from drop-down) where you are purchasing your property. 

Factors Affecting Ready Reckoner Rate in Thane

So, there are various factors upon which the RRR varies or fluctuates, including amenities offered, the market dynamics of the property, and the type of property.

The Annual Statement of Rates (ASR)/RRR is divided by area (urban, rural, influence) and subzones. You see higher rates in urban areas, and you will notice lower rates in rural areas.

Rates also vary on property types; commercial spaces have higher rates while residential have lower rates.

If the property is situated in a convenient location, close to all local amenities (hospitals, educational institutions, shops, etc.), then the rates are considerably higher.
